Title: Tetsuo Asano: Innovator in Fluorescent Lamp Technology
Introduction
Tetsuo Asano is a notable inventor based in Mobara, Japan. He has made significant contributions to the field of lighting technology, particularly in the development of advanced fluorescent lamps. With a total of 7 patents to his name, Asano's work has had a lasting impact on the industry.
Latest Patents
One of Asano's latest patents is for a fluorescent lamp made of glass with a specific composition. This invention aims to provide fluorescent lamps that serve as light sources for liquid crystal display devices. The lamps exhibit excellent characteristics in preventing solarization, blocking ultraviolet rays, and maintaining physical and thermal strength while preventing scratching. The glass composition includes various oxides, such as SiO, BO, AlO, and rare earth elements, ensuring optimal performance.
Another significant patent involves a cathode ray tube equipped with a faceplate that has a convex outer surface and a lens assembly. This design enhances focus characteristics and high resolution by eliminating deviations between the phosphor screen center and the lens assembly center. The faceplate's surfaces are formed as spherical convex surfaces, which are curved toward the electron gun, further improving the device's performance.
